For Gumbos, I do the baked method courtesy of Paul Prudhomme. 2 cups rice, 2 1/2 cups stock, 2 Tablespoons melted butter and a few dashes of garlic powder, salt, white, black and cayenne pepper. Mix in a baking loaf pan and seal with foil and bake for 90 minutes. Perfect everytime. You can also add small amounts of minced onion, bell pepper and celery too but adding stock in lieu of water is the key.
